Impact Absorption and Safety Features
Now, let's talk about the features that actually keep you safe, yeah? The Chrysler 300 is equipped with a range of safety features designed to absorb impact and protect passengers. The car's crumple zones are strategically placed throughout the body to absorb energy in the event of a collision, reducing the force transmitted to the occupants. Airbags, including front, side, and curtain airbags, provide an extra layer of protection, cushioning passengers during a crash. The advanced braking systems, such as ABS and electronic stability control, help prevent accidents by maintaining control of the vehicle. These features work in tandem to minimize the risk of injury. Furthermore, the design of the interior focuses on passenger safety, with elements like reinforced seats and seatbelts that provide enhanced protection during a crash. The Chrysler 300 constantly receives updates and enhancements to its safety features. These updates reflect Chrysler’s continuous efforts to improve vehicle safety and meet the latest standards. The combination of structural design and advanced safety technology makes the Chrysler 300 a secure vehicle, offering peace of mind to drivers and passengers alike. The integration of impact absorption features and safety technologies proves Chrysler’s dedication to providing a safe driving experience.

Suspension System Components and Their Role
Alright, let's break down the components. The suspension system of the Chrysler 300 includes several key components that work together to provide a smooth and controlled ride. These components include shock absorbers, struts, springs, and control arms. Shock absorbers and struts are designed to dampen the movement of the wheels, absorbing bumps and road imperfections. Springs support the weight of the vehicle and maintain its ride height. Control arms connect the wheels to the chassis and allow for movement. The quality and design of these components directly impact the car’s handling and ride comfort. Chrysler uses high-quality materials and engineering to design these components, ensuring their durability and performance. Regular maintenance, such as inspections and replacements when necessary, is essential to maintain the suspension’s effectiveness. The proper functioning of these components contributes to the Chrysler 300’s overall strength and reliability. The integration and quality of these suspension system components enhance the car's driving experience and overall safety.
